Fireblocks Lets Institutions Finally Stop Letting Stablecoins Nap

Fireblocks just dropped Earn, a new product that lets institutions stop watching idle stablecoin balances like a cat watching a laser pointer and actually route that capital into onchain lending through Aave and Morpho. Because apparently, even crypto whales get existential watching their money just... exist.

The feature hits Early Access with a Sentora-curated vault on Morpho plus direct access to Aave's lending markets. No fixed yields were mentioned—because DeFi doesn't do promises, it does vibes and variable APYs that could technically decide to take a vacation to zero. Plot twist!

Fireblocks claims it handled $6 trillion in stablecoin transfers during 2025 across 2,400 institutional clients—a 300% year-over-year spike. That's a staggering amount of coins just vibing between settlement windows, probably passive-aggressively judging their owners.

CEO Michael Shaulov spun it as a productivity upgrade: institutions can now deploy idle capital through onchain strategies curated by other institutions, all within the same platform they already use. Same controls, same security, just fewer awkward silences in boardrooms when someone asks "so what are we doing with the stablecoins again?"

Aave remains the undisputed king of decentralized lending with $25.9 billion in TVL, while Morpho sits comfortably at $7.67 billion, according to DeFiLlama. The launch puts Fireblocks in a cozy little club with other institutional yield gateways: Aave Horizon, Coinbase Prime, and Spark Institutional Lending.

In a "we're definitely adults now" flex, Fireblocks has been stacking enterprise tools like a crypto bear market stacks red candles: partnering on a NYDFS-backed custody framework in October 2025, then dropping $130 million to acquire tax-compliant accounting platform TRES in January 2026. Because nothing screams institutional maturity quite like compliance documentation and depreciation schedules.
